Setting Boundaries for Healthier Love Life
One of the best strategies to combat dating burnout is to set clear boundaries. Limit your app usage to a few minutes a day. Designate specific times during the week to respond to messages or go on dates. These boundaries not only prevent burnout but also help you stay grounded and intentional.
Additionally, prioritize emotional availability. If you're still healing from a breakup or feeling insecure, pause and reflect. Modern dating tips and trends often focus on being proactive, but true emotional readiness is a foundational step that many overlook.
Reframing Your Dating Mindset
Instead of seeing dating as a quest for perfection, view it as an opportunity for growth and connection. Not every conversation or date needs to lead to something long-term. When you release the pressure of outcome-driven dating, you make space for genuine connections.
Try journaling after each date—not to judge the person, but to assess how you felt. Were you energized, comfortable, and respected? These reflections are far more important than a checklist of traits. This perspective shift will help you avoid disappointment and stay aligned with your personal values.
Safe and Empowered Dating
Burnout isn’t just emotional—it’s about safety too. In the age of digital romance, understanding online dating safety tips is vital. Meet in public places, tell a friend where you’re going, and never share personal financial information. Trust your intuition. The emotional safety of feeling respected and valued is just as important as physical security.

Flirting for Introverted or Anxious
Not everyone is naturally outgoing, and that’s okay. Flirting tips for shy people often focus on subtle yet sincere gestures—smiling, asking questions, or complimenting something unique. You don’t have to be bold to be charming.
For those struggling with shyness, practice light conversations in low-pressure settings. It helps build confidence and makes interactions on apps or dates feel more natural and less scripted.
